Loadbalancer.class.

6 days ago · Load Balancer Class (LoadBalancer): Maintain a list of server names. Implement a method (getNextServer) that returns the next server in a round-robin fashion. Keep track of the current index to determine the next server. Main Class (RoundRobinExample): Create a list of server names to be used in the load balancer.

Loadbalancer.class. Things To Know About Loadbalancer.class.

Just a bit background here, what we will do is the following −. Start the Eureka Server. Start two instances of the Customer Service. Start a Restaurant Service which internally calls Customer Service and uses the Spring Cloud Load balancer. Make four API calls to the Restaurant Service. Ideally, two requests would be served by each customer ... 2 – creating the ALB. Once the target group exists, then configure an Application Load Balancer. This is done in exactly the same way as the configuration in Region. For the ALB to be accessible from on-premises, the type must be “internet-facing.”. At that point, you can select an IP pool owned by the customer.If loadBalancerAttributes is set, the attributes defined will be applied to the load balancer that belong to this IngressClass. If you specify invalid keys or values for the load balancer attributes, the controller will fail to reconcile ingresses belonging to the particular ingress class. If loadBalancerAttributes un-specified, Ingresses with ...Aug 19, 2019 · Direct Routing (DR) load balancing method. The one-arm direct routing (DR) mode is recommended for Loadbalancer.org installations because it's a very high performance solution requiring little change to your existing infrastructure. ( NB. Foundry networks call this and F5 call it. works by changing the destination MAC address of the …Terraform AWS Application Load Balancer. A Terraform module for building an application load balancer in AWS. The load balancer requires: An existing VPC. Some existing subnets. A domain name and public and private hosted zones. The application load balancer consists of: An ALB. Deployed across the provided subnet IDs.

2 days ago · AWS Load Balancer Controller supports LoadBalancerClass feature since v2.4.0 release for Kubernetes v1.22+ clusters. LoadBalancerClass feature provides a …

Oct 13, 2023 · LoadBalancerClient 翻译过来就是负载均衡客户端: LoadBalancerClient 取=寻找服务的简单流程: Ribbon 里面封装了 获取全部服务的接口 (getallserverlists的方法), 其 …

#NOTE: The clusterName value must be set either via the values.yaml or the Helm command line. The <k8s-cluster-name> in the command \n # below should be replaced with name of your k8s cluster before running it. \nhelm upgrade -i aws-load-balancer-controller eks/aws-load-balancer-controller -n kube-system --set clusterName= < k8s-cluster …2 days ago · Spring Cloud provides its own client-side load-balancer abstraction and implementation. For the load-balancing mechanism, ReactiveLoadBalancer interface has been added and a Round-Robin-based and Random implementations have been provided for it. In order to get instances to select from reactive ServiceInstanceListSupplier is …3. Netflix ribbon – Client side load balancer. Netflix ribbon from Spring Cloud family provides such facility to set up client side load balancing along with the service registry component. Spring boot has very nice way of configuring ribbon client side load balancer with minimal effort. It provides the following features.Aug 22, 2019 · 최근, 누군가 NodePort와 LoadBalancer, Ingress가 무엇인지 차이를 물어 왔다. 셋 다 클러스터 내부로 외부 트래픽을 가져오는 방법이지만, 모두 다른 방법으로 구현하고 있다. 각각이 어떻게 작동하는지 살펴 보고, 어떤 경우에 사용해야 하는지 알아 보자. 주의: 이 글의 ...Nov 22, 2023 · public abstract class LoadBalancer extends Object implements ExtensionPoint. Strategy that decides which Queue.Task gets run on which Executor . Even though this is marked as ExtensionPoint, you do not register your implementation with @ Extension. Instead, call Queue.setLoadBalancer (LoadBalancer) to install your …

Oct 27, 2023 · You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window. Reload to refresh your session. You switched accounts on another tab or window.

In order to create and use a custom load balancer you can do the following. Below we setup a basic load balancing config and not the Type is CustomLoadBalancer which is the name of a class we will setup to do load balancing. Then you need to create a class that implements the ILoadBalancer interface.

Improve availability and scalability of your applications by distributing network traffic. Load-balance internet and private network traffic with high performance and low latency. Instantly add scale to your applications and enable high availability. Load Balancer works across virtual machines, virtual machine scale sets, and IP addresses. Apr 14, 2017 · 9:43 Passing the Client’s IP Address to the Backend. One of the biggest challenges with using a TCP and UDP load balancer is passing the client’s IP address. Your business requirements might call for that, but maybe your proxy doesn’t have the information. Of course, there are ways in HTTP to do that quite easily.1 day ago · The DNS servers resolve the DNS name of your load balancer to the private IP addresses of the load balancer nodes for your internal load balancer. Each load balancer node is connected to the private IP addresses of the back-end instances using elastic network interfaces. If cross-zone load balancing is enabled, each node is connected to …Mar 8, 2021 · Sorted by: 2. The LoadBalancer config should not be in a @Configuration -annotated class; instead, it should be a class passed for config via @LoadBalancerClient or @LoadBalancerClients annotation, as described here. Also, the only bean you need to instantiate is the ServiceInstanceListSupplier (if you add spring-cloud-starter-loadbalancer ... Jan 27, 2024 · AWS Load Balancer Controller를 설치합니다. Amazon EC2 인스턴스 메타데이터 서비스 (IMDS)에 대해 제한적인 액세스 권한 이 있는 Amazon EC2 노드에 컨트롤러를 배포하거나 Fargate에 배포하는 경우, 다음 helm 명령에 다음 플래그를 추가합니다. --set region= region-code. --set vpcId= vpc ...Aug 22, 2019 · 최근, 누군가 NodePort와 LoadBalancer, Ingress가 무엇인지 차이를 물어 왔다. 셋 다 클러스터 내부로 외부 트래픽을 가져오는 방법이지만, 모두 다른 방법으로 구현하고 있다. 각각이 어떻게 작동하는지 살펴 보고, 어떤 경우에 사용해야 하는지 알아 보자. 주의: 이 글의 ...load-balancer-class: string: service.k8s.aws/nlb: Name of the load balancer class specified in service spec.loadBalancerClass reconciled by this controller: log-level: string: info: Set the controller log level - info, debug: metrics-bind-addr: string:8080: The address the metric endpoint binds to: service-max-concurrent-reconciles: int: 3

Welcome to the VMware NSX Advanced Load Balancer (formerly known as Avi Networks). The NSX Advanced Load Balancer makes it easy to apply load balancing, web application firewall, and container ingress to any application in any datacenter and cloud. This guide assumes that you chose Java. Click Dependencies and select Spring Web (for the Say Hello project) or Cloud Loadbalancer and Spring Reactive Web (for the User project). Click Generate. Download the resulting ZIP file, which is an archive of a web application that is configured with your choices. Discovery can collect data about network routers, switches, and applications. Discovery supports data collection from the following applications and hardware: A10 Apache mod_jk and Apache mod_proxy Big-IP. 2 days ago · id - The ARN of the load balancer (matches arn). subnet_mapping.*.outpost_id - ID of the Outpost containing the load balancer. tags_all - A map of tags assigned to the resource, including those inherited from the provider default_tags configuration block. zone_id - The canonical hosted zone ID of the load …Layer 4 load balancing uses information defined at the networking transport layer (Layer 4) as the basis for deciding how to distribute client requests across a group of servers. For Internet traffic specifically, a Layer 4 load balancer bases the load-balancing decision on the source and destination IP addresses and ports recorded in the packet header, without …

Nov 22, 2023 · Class BaseLoadBalancer. @InterfaceAudience.Private public abstract class BaseLoadBalancer extends Object implements LoadBalancer. The base class for load balancers. It provides the the functions used to by AssignmentManager to assign regions in the edge cases. It doesn't provide an implementation of the actual balancing …

4 days ago · Overview. Google Cloud's external Application Load Balancer is a globally distributed load balancer for exposing applications publicly on the internet. It's deployed across Google Points of Presence (PoPs) globally providing low latency HTTP (S) connections to users. Anycast routing is used for the load balancer IPs, allowing internet …Sep 19, 2023 · Load balancing is an essential technique used in cloud computing to optimize resource utilization and ensure that no single resource is overburdened with traffic. It is a process of distributing workloads across multiple computing resources, such as servers, virtual machines, or containers, to achieve better performance, availability, and ... Nov 20, 2019 · The Application Load Balancer operates at Layer 7 of the OSI model, the network load balancer distributes traffic based on Layer 4. However, the classic load balancer works at both Layer 4 and 7. The Classic Load Balancer is a connection-based balancer where requests are forwarded by the load balancer without “looking into” any of these ... Oct 23, 2020 · The ALB Ingress Controller is now the AWS Load Balancer Controller, and includes support for both Application Load Balancers and Network Load Balancers.The new controller enables you to simplify operations and save costs by sharing an Application Load Balancer across multiple applications in your Kubernetes cluster, as well as using a Network Load Balancer to target pods running on AWS Fargate. Jun 25, 2019 · I want the cluster to have a LoadBalancer and a static public IP, and I want those to be pre-existing to my Ingress Controller / LoadBalancer Service definitions, as I don't want them to be created/deleted dynamically by Kubernetes manifests.The LoadBalancerClass feature provides a CloudProvider agnostic way of offloading the reconciliation for Kubernetes Service resources of type LoadBalancer to an external controller. When you specify the spec.loadBalancerClass to be service.k8s.aws/nlb on a Kubernetes Service resource of type LoadBalancer, the LBC takes charge of reconciliation ... Mar 8, 2021 · Sorted by: 2. The LoadBalancer config should not be in a @Configuration -annotated class; instead, it should be a class passed for config via @LoadBalancerClient or @LoadBalancerClients annotation, as described here. Also, the only bean you need to instantiate is the ServiceInstanceListSupplier (if you add spring-cloud-starter-loadbalancer ... Jan 24, 2024 · Note. TKG v2.5 does not support clusters on AWS or Azure. See the End of Support for TKG Management and Workload Clusters on AWS and Azure in the Tanzu Kubernetes Grid v2.5 Release Notes.. If you are installing Contour to a vSphere cluster that uses NSX ALB as a load balancer service provider, modify the contour-default …

Apr 14, 2017 · 9:43 Passing the Client’s IP Address to the Backend. One of the biggest challenges with using a TCP and UDP load balancer is passing the client’s IP address. Your business requirements might call for that, but maybe your proxy doesn’t have the information. Of course, there are ways in HTTP to do that quite easily.

Kubernetes LoadBalancer Class (Kubernetes v1.24+) (kube-vip v0.5.0+) The watcher will always examine the load balancer class , and if it isn't set then will assume that classes aren't being set and act upon the service.

The LoadBalancerClass feature provides a CloudProvider agnostic way of offloading the reconciliation for Kubernetes Service resources of type LoadBalancer to an external controller. When you specify the spec.loadBalancerClass to be service.k8s.aws/nlb on a Kubernetes Service resource of type LoadBalancer, the LBC takes charge of …Oct 30, 2020 · One of the most popular ways to use services in AWS is with the loadBalancer type. With a simple YAML file declaring your service name, port, and label selector, the cloud controller will provision a load balancer for you automatically. apiVersion: v1 kind: Service metadata: name: search-svc # the name of our service spec: type: loadBalancer ... 1 day ago · You can request increases for some quotas, and other quotas cannot be increased. To view the quotas for your Application Load Balancers, open the Service Quotas console. In the navigation pane, choose AWS services and select Elastic Load Balancing. You can also use the describe-account-limits (AWS CLI) command for Elastic Load …Improve availability and scalability of your applications by distributing network traffic. Load-balance internet and private network traffic with high performance and low latency. Instantly add scale to your applications and enable high availability. Load Balancer works across virtual machines, virtual machine scale sets, and IP addresses. LoadBalancer class. LoadBalancer. class. A pool of runners, ordered by load. Keeps a pool of runners, and allows running function through the runner with the lowest current load. …Apr 10, 2022 · Spring Cloud LoadBalancer源码分析我们先从RestTemplate负载均衡的简单实现来分析入手,除此之外其支持Spring Web Flux响应式编程的实现原理思想也是相 …Terraform AWS Application Load Balancer. A Terraform module for building an application load balancer in AWS. The load balancer requires: An existing VPC. Some existing subnets. A domain name and public and private hosted zones. The application load balancer consists of: An ALB. Deployed across the provided subnet IDs. The bgp-speaker DaemonSet has been renamed to just speaker. Before applying the manifest for 0.3.0, delete the old daemonset with kubectl delete -n metallb-system ds/bgp-speaker. This will take down your load balancers until you deploy the new DaemonSet.#NOTE: The clusterName value must be set either via the values.yaml or the Helm command line. The <k8s-cluster-name> in the command \n # below should be replaced with name of your k8s cluster before running it. \nhelm upgrade -i aws-load-balancer-controller eks/aws-load-balancer-controller -n kube-system --set clusterName= < k8s-cluster …Just a bit background here, what we will do is the following −. Start the Eureka Server. Start two instances of the Customer Service. Start a Restaurant Service which internally calls Customer Service and uses the Spring Cloud Load balancer. Make four API calls to the Restaurant Service. Ideally, two requests would be served by each customer ... Aug 19, 2019 · Direct Routing (DR) load balancing method. The one-arm direct routing (DR) mode is recommended for Loadbalancer.org installations because it's a very high performance solution requiring little change to your existing infrastructure. ( NB. Foundry networks call this and F5 call it. works by changing the destination MAC address of the …

Aug 4, 2023 · In your system design interview, you’ll be asked some sort of scalability question where you’ll have to explain how load balancers help distribute the traffic and how it ensures scalability and availability of services in your application. The overall concept that you need to keep in mind from this article is….Jan 22, 2024 · 자세한 내용은 AWS Load Balancer Controller 추가 기능 설치 섹션을 참조하세요. 버전 2.5.4 이상을 사용하는 것이 좋습니다. 서로 다른 가용 영역에 두 개 이상의 서브넷을 보유해야 합니다. AWS Load Balancer Controller는 각 가용 영역에서 서브넷을 하나씩 선택합니다.Aug 4, 2023 · In your system design interview, you’ll be asked some sort of scalability question where you’ll have to explain how load balancers help distribute the traffic and how it ensures scalability and availability of services in your application. The overall concept that you need to keep in mind from this article is….Load balancing is the practice of distributing computational workloads between two or more computers. On the Internet, load balancing is often employed to divide network traffic among several servers. This reduces the strain on each server and makes the servers more efficient, speeding up performance and reducing latency.Instagram:https://instagram. class envato market apistep mom creampiedwarning shoplifters will be pro ass ecutedvideo porno Load balancer service key. object_id. Load balancer service key. name. Load balancer service name. short_description. ... The class cmdb_ci_lb is s subclass of the cmdb_cI_computer class and really should be for hardware, not the "application" running on the hardware. Apr 17, 2020 07:48Classic Load Balancer overview. A load balancer distributes incoming application traffic across multiple EC2 instances in multiple Availability Zones. This increases the fault tolerance of your applications. Elastic Load Balancing detects unhealthy instances and routes traffic only to healthy instances. Your load balancer serves as a single ... susu jpg leaksandved2ahukewiqj8r5 zqdaxxtj4kehdzpc wqfnoecbeqaqandusgaovvaw2aytrjefmkc07legnorekc11k bloxburg house no gamepass Aug 13, 2023 · 在文章 openFeign让http调用更简单 中介绍了基于openfeign的http客户端调用,但是其实还有一个地方没有介绍,就是openfeign从注册中心获取了服务的实例列表 …Traffic Manager is a DNS-based traffic load balancer that enables you to distribute traffic optimally to services across global Azure regions, while providing high availability and responsiveness. Because Traffic Manager is a DNS-based load-balancing service, it load balances only at the domain level. For that reason, it can't fail over as quickly as Azure … ku associate The basic definitions are simple: A reverse proxy accepts a request from a client, forwards it to a server that can fulfill it, and returns the server’s response to the client. A load balancer distributes incoming client requests among a group of servers, in each case returning the response from the selected server to the appropriate client.Welcome to the VMware NSX Advanced Load Balancer (formerly known as Avi Networks). The NSX Advanced Load Balancer makes it easy to apply load balancing, web application firewall, and container ingress to any application in any datacenter and cloud.#NOTE: The clusterName value must be set either via the values.yaml or the Helm command line. The <k8s-cluster-name> in the command \n # below should be replaced with name of your k8s cluster before running it. \nhelm upgrade -i aws-load-balancer-controller eks/aws-load-balancer-controller -n kube-system --set clusterName= < k8s-cluster …